Output fce61f6995efd38550b4fecab2afef4049547ab679325b4023edeaf0b164b6c4:7

value
12021268
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d236d4478326ea6e0fc4f750f5904965220b2bcc OP_EQUAL
address
3LrXWRpyHEforJVEmhAYLWNgUvvL1cFF8n
transaction
fce61f6995efd38550b4fecab2afef4049547ab679325b4023edeaf0b164b6c4
confirmations
467916
spent
true